Clinton to offer health care plan - Yahoo! News: "The centerpiece of Clinton's plan is the so-called 'individual mandate,' requiring everyone to have health insurance — just as most states require drivers to purchase auto insurance."

This is great on so many levels. First, requiring insurance by law is a HUGE gift to the corporations. Second, look how good the auto insurance industry made out with the laws requiring it. In NY, when i financed a vehicle, which requires full-coverage, I was paying 260 a month for the car, 280 for the insurance. Insurance is supposed to divide risk amongst a pool of people, but I was paying more for insurance than I was for the vehicle.
